What Influences the Best Dumpster Rental Period
There are multiple things to consider when deciding how long to rent a dumpster. Big projects create more debris and often call for longer rental periods. The type of materials you are discarding also matters because some projects involve heavier or bulkier items that take longer to remove safely. Considering these factors helps you make a realistic estimate of the time you will need.
Bad weather and shifting deadlines can extend the time required. Storms or wet conditions might slow your work, meaning the dumpster stays longer. Coordinating with other contractors or helpers may also influence how quickly you can fill the dumpster. We are ready to work with you to modify rental times when plans shift. Keeping your rental period flexible makes managing unexpected issues much easier.

Smart Scheduling to Avoid Additional Costs
People often want to know how to prevent penalties for overdue rentals. Properly arranging your rental period from the beginning check here reduces the risk of overage charges. When you expect delays, notifying the provider ahead of time helps secure an extension. This simple step keeps everything on track without unexpected expenses. Having a set end date means the container is removed before it becomes an obstacle.
How you fill the container can directly affect your schedule. Disassembling furniture and flattening boxes helps fit more waste while preventing overflow. When the container is loaded properly, pickups are faster and safer. We educate customers on loading tips to keep everything running smoothly. With the right approach, you can meet your deadlines without needing extra days.
